#37 of 51 Re: 2005 Highlander V6 upgrades [dodge] by MrShift@Edmunds HOST

Aug 02, 2005 (7:02 am)

Replying to: dodge (Aug 02, 2005 12:03 am)
Well this particular type of mod is outside my knowledge. You know what I'd do? I'd have a nice long consultation with a respected speed shop in your area. If you lived in the San Fran Bay Area I could direct you. But otherwise, this type of work needs to be carefully planned out and budgeted.
 
I'd imagine you definitely would have to turbo the car, and being a V-6 that's probably twin turbos. I really don't know if anyone's done that--I'm sure some gearhead has, and I'm sure some really motivated speed shop would help you take it on. Now if you want to be world's deadliest SUV stoplight jockey maybe a supercharger would work better for fitment, as turbo plumbing does tend to get complex. But I think a turbo would still be cheaper by a bit.
 
My thinking is that you need a LOT more HP and this can't be done with that engine and normal aspiration.
